The Gigabit Ethernet Camera market has gained substantial traction due to increasing demands in automation, surveillance, and machine vision applications. The market is characterized by a variety of players that offer robust imaging solutions catering to diverse industrial needs.

Teledyne DALSA is a prominent player known for its advanced imaging technologies, specializing in high-resolution cameras equipped with Gigabit Ethernet interfaces. The company’s solutions are widely used in industrial automation, robotics, and quality control, helping to drive market growth through innovation and reliability.

Allied Vision focuses on providing versatile Gigabit Ethernet cameras that cater to various applications—ranging from factory automation to scientific research. Their commitment to integrating artificial intelligence features enhances the functionality of their cameras, making them more appealing for modern applications, thus contributing to the market's expansion.

JAI, another key player, differentiates itself through customized solutions, offering multi-sensor cameras with Gigabit Ethernet support. Their technology delivers high-quality images for various applications, including automotive and medical imaging, thereby enlarging their customer base and stimulating market growth.

Point Grey Research, now part of Teledyne Technologies, has historically been a pioneer in the development of Gigabit Ethernet cameras. Focusing on high-speed imaging and advanced connectivity options, they provide reliable solutions that target industries such as aerospace and security, strengthening the overall market landscape.

Gigabit Ethernet cameras come in two main types: monochrome and color. Monochrome cameras capture images in shades of gray, excelling in low-light conditions and providing high sensitivity, making them ideal for applications like surveillance and scientific imaging. Color cameras offer vibrant images and are suited for applications requiring detailed visuals, such as traffic monitoring and quality control in manufacturing.
